The Data Explosion
Unprecedented Data Generation
Every day, we generate an astonishing amount of data—from social media interactions and online transactions to IoT devices and sensor data. According to estimates, the global data sphere is expected to reach an astounding 175 zettabytes by 2025. This explosion of data presents both challenges and opportunities for organizations looking to harness its potential.
Enhanced Data Collection Tools
In 2024, advancements in data collection technologies, including AI-driven analytics and cloud computing, have made it easier than ever for organizations to gather and store data. Tools such as automated data pipelines and real-time analytics platforms enable businesses to collect valuable insights swiftly, driving informed decision-making.

Key Trends Shaping Data Science in 2024
Artificial Intelligence and Machine Learning Integration
The integration of AI and machine learning with data science is driving innovation. In 2024, organizations are increasingly adopting automated machine learning (AutoML) tools, enabling data scientists to build and deploy models more efficiently. This trend is democratizing access to advanced analytics, allowing non-experts to leverage data insights.
Focus on Ethics and Data Privacy
As data collection practices become more sophisticated, the importance of ethics and data privacy cannot be overstated. In 2024, organizations are prioritizing transparency and compliance with regulations like GDPR and CCPA. Data scientists are expected to incorporate ethical considerations into their analyses, ensuring that data usage respects privacy and fosters trust.
Real-Time Analytics
The demand for real-time analytics is surging. In a fast-paced business environment, organizations need immediate insights to make timely decisions. Data science tools that support real-time data processing and visualization are becoming essential for staying competitive.
Skills for Success in Data Science
As data science continues to evolve, certain skills are becoming increasingly important for professionals in the field:
Programming Languages
Proficiency in languages such as Python and R is crucial for data analysis and model development. Familiarity with SQL for database management is also essential.Statistical Analysis
A strong foundation in statistics is vital for interpreting data accurately and making informed decisions.Machine Learning Expertise
Understanding machine learning algorithms and techniques is essential for building predictive models and extracting insights from complex datasets.Data Visualization
The ability to present data insights effectively is crucial. Familiarity with visualization tools like Tableau, Power BI, or D3.js can significantly enhance communication of findings.Soft Skills
Strong communication skills are necessary for collaborating with cross-functional teams and conveying insights to stakeholders. Critical thinking and problem-solving abilities are also essential for addressing complex data challenges.
